The Eaton Bussmann SC-5 is a 5A, 600V Class G fast-acting power fuse designed for use in inline fuse holders and industrial electrical applications. With a 200kA interrupt rating and melamine body construction, it delivers reliable overcurrent protection in demanding environments. UL Listed, CSA Certified, and CE Marked for broad compliance.

Frequently Asked Questions
What inline fuse holders is the SC-5 compatible with?
The Eaton Bussmann SC-5 is a Class G fuse measuring 7/16" diameter x 1-5/16" length. It is compatible with inline fuse holders designed for Class G SC-series fuses. Verify your holder's fuse class and size before ordering.
What does "fast-acting" mean for a fuse?
A fast-acting fuse responds immediately to overcurrent conditions without intentional time delay. This makes it ideal for protecting sensitive equipment where rapid disconnection is required to prevent damage.
What is the interrupt rating of the SC-5?
The SC-5 has a 200kA interrupt rating, meaning it can safely interrupt fault currents up to 200,000 amperes without rupturing or causing a hazard.
